During this informative session, Professor Zach Murphy will delve into the complexities of atrial fibrillation, or A Fib. He will provide a thorough and methodical overview of this condition’s underlying causes and physiological mechanisms, covering cardiac and non-cardiac factors. Furthermore, he will highlight vital clinical indicators that aid in the diagnosis of atrial fibrillation and explore the latest treatment options available.
